Cedar took a seven-run defeat the last time they faced off against Cyprus, but this time they managed to keep it close and that made all the difference. The Cedar Reds won by a run and slipped past the Cyprus Pirates 4-3. The victory was familiar territory for the Reds, who have now won five matches in a row.

Sadie Parson sp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ered just two earned (and one unearned) runs on eight hits. She has been consistent : she hasn't given up more than two walks in five consecutive appearances.

On the hitting side, the team relied heavily on Kinzie Hawkins, who went 2-for-3 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one double. That's the most hits she has posted since back in April of 2024. Elicia Garcia also deserves some recognition as she snagged her first stolen base of the season.

Cedar was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.429.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Cyprus only posted a batting average of .276.

Cedar's win bumped their record up to 5-2. As for Cyprus, their loss dropped their record down to 4-2.

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Cedar will face off against Hurricane at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Cedar is facing Hurricane at the right time seeing as Hurricane is stuck on a three-game losing streak. As for Cyprus, they will take on Hunter at 3: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Cyprus' pitching crew has only allowed 3.5 runs per game this season, so Hunter's hitters will have their work cut out for them.
